How to Use Podcasts and Videos to Study for Social Media Certifications
Studying for social media certifications can be both thrilling and challenging. One effective strategy is to incorporate multimedia elements like podcasts and videos into your learning routine. Podcasts are an incredible resource that allow you to absorb information on the go; you can listen while commuting or exercising. Various experts in social media share insights through interviews and discussions, presenting current trends and strategies. This auditory learning appeals to visual and auditory learners alike. Videos, on the other hand, offer dynamic and visual ways to grasp concepts. You can watch tutorials or instructional videos that break down complicated subjects into digestible segments. Platforms like YouTube or dedicated educational websites often provide comprehensive content. Combining these methods with traditional reading can enhance retention and understanding. The key is to create a structured study plan that includes both forms of media. For example, outlining specific topics to cover each week can create a focused approach. Incorporate quizzes or reflection points after each session to solidify knowledge. Ultimately, your goal is to build a well-rounded understanding of social media strategies and best practices. Engaging multiple senses can lead to enhanced learning outcomes.

Finding the Right Resources
The next crucial step is selecting the right podcasts and videos from which to learn. Start by identifying trustworthy sources that focus on social media education. Look for established experts or reputable organizations with a solid history in producing educational material. Selecting content created by recognized industry leaders will ensure the quality and relevance of the material presented. Explore popular podcast platforms like Spotify or Apple Podcasts to find shows dedicated to social media. Search using terms such as “social media marketing” or “digital strategy” to discover localized offerings. When it comes to videos, platforms like YouTube offer countless channels that focus on social media strategies, presenting diverse learning prospects. It’s helpful to read reviews or ratings when choosing podcasts or video content to ensure they resonate with your learning preferences. If possible, preview episodes or recordings to gauge whether the delivery style suits your learning needs. Engaging with a variety of resources can expand your knowledge base and provide different perspectives on essential topics. Be proactive in seeking out new content to stay informed and encourage growth in your understanding of social media certifications.

Measuring Progress and Adjusting Techniques
As you integrate podcasts and videos into your study routine, consider measuring your progress regularly. Evaluate how well the multimedia content enhances your understanding and retention. Setting specific learning goals for each session can provide clearer benchmarks to assess progress. For example, after finishing a podcast series, reflect on your comprehension of its main concepts. Consider incorporating assessments or quizzes that test your knowledge. This could involve online quizzes or creating flashcards from your notes. Adjust your study schedule based on the effectiveness of your chosen resources and any identified weaknesses. If a particular podcast or video series doesn’t resonate, don’t hesitate to seek alternatives; after all, the goal is to absorb the material effectively. Engaging with varied formats also helps identify what techniques work best for you. Consider mixing formats or trying other related media, like webinars or online workshops. By constantly evaluating your approach, you can ensure your study regimen is closely aligned with your learning style, maximizing your efficiency and effectiveness in preparation for certifying assessments.
